Command Function
exit
This command
returns to the
previous configura-
tion mode or exit
the configuration
program.
Default Setting: None
Command Mode: Any
Example: This example shows how to return to the Privileged Exec mode from the
Global Configuration mode, and then quit the CLI session:
Console(config)#exit
Console#exit
Press ENTER to start session
User Access Verification
Username:
quit
This command exits
the configuration
program.
Default Setting: None
Command Mode: Normal Exec, Privileged Exec
Command Usage: The quit and exit commands can both exit the configuration program.
Example: This example shows how to quit a CLI session:
Console#quit
